Peru's national soccer team is already in the United States to face Croatia and Iceland in the first two friendlies prior to the 2018 World Cup.
They were welcomed by a large number of fans, who gathered outside Wilcox Field Airport to take a picture with them.
Likewise, supporters awaited coach
Ricardo Gareca to greet and hug him.
It must be noted the Inca squad is staying at Sawgrass Grand Hotel.
Following the Croatia match, Peruvians will join training sessions in preparation for their next friendly against Iceland, which is slated to be played in New Jersey.
